Tivoli, I would just pick out the essential selling points and combine them into a list. I'm a bit like you - don't like widgets or gadgets or anything much that upsets the flow of my website, but just as an example, this is my bullet point list:
  • IN A NUTSHELL
    stunning barn conversion for one couple
    just for grown ups
    spacious open plan sitting room with well equipped kitchen and dining area
    bedroom with king size bed and second sitting area
    large bathroom with XXL shower
    second bedroom, shower room and extra sitting room can be added for two couples
    lots of extras
    green and environment friendly
    private terraces and garden, managed organically
    non smoking (including outside)
    open April to October, minimum booking 7 nights
    totally flexible arrival days throughout season
    simple, transparent and inclusive price - the same all year
I have it close to the top of the detailed page for the accommodation, next to a large photo. Then below those are the detailed narrative paragraphs and photos. That way, if the nutshell version puts someone off, they don't need to scroll down and read any more.
